## Phase 2: Extracting the user module

Plugin authors: the Corvette monolith's user module is now served by the standalone Ailsworth service. Update your plugins to call Ailsworth directly rather than the legacy internal path, which returns deprecation warnings until the next release. Requests must authenticate against the Ailsworth staging gateway with the key below.

service key, kaduf-bawig: kto15_Ze79S0dligTw0yO

## Service Accounts — StormFan Alert Fan-Out

The fan-out worker authenticates to the internal dispatch tier using the svc-stormfan account. Rotate quarterly; scopes are limited to publish-only on alert topics. If deliveries stall during your shift, verify the worker is using the current credential, reproduced below for reference.

API key for kaweg-hahif: kto4_rAjZ

Handing off the Quillbus broker upgrade (4.x to 5.1) to Dario. Cluster is half-migrated; mixed-version mode is supported but TLS cert rotation must finish before cutover. No auth model changes, though the admin API gained two new endpoints worth reviewing. Open questions and the migration checklist are tracked on the internal page below.

dashboard of taduf-bawef = https://jira.lumicsys.internal/projects/display/browse/b1cbf89d

#
# So, websocket compression on Birchline is a classic tradeoff. Turning
# permessage-deflate all the way up saved us ~55% bandwidth in the Toller
# load tests, but memory per connection ballooned because each socket
# keeps its own deflate context. With 20k idle dashboards connected,
# that's real money. Our compromise: modest window bits, skip tiny
# frames entirely (compressing a 40-byte ping is pure waste), and drop
# context takeover for the public tier. Don't tweak these without
# rerunning the soak test. The tuned constants follow.

tuning constants:
QUOTAS = {
    "druwyn": 5,
    "holix": 5,
    "zorath": 5,
    "holwyn": 10,
}